Title: Gold Green Blue Gradient – Contemporary Iridescent Abstract Painting.
This contemporary abstract painting was created with a painting knife using acrylic paint on cotton canvas stretched over a wooden frame (100% cotton).
The gold, green, and blue colors blend together in a luminous, iridescent gradient that varies depending on the lighting.
The texture worked with the knife adds depth and relief to the composition.
The edges of the canvas are painted black, allowing for immediate enhancement without framing.
The entire painting is protected with a glossy spray-on varnish to ensure shine and durability. Video of the work available: https://youtu.be/sMXufBzolw8

Gold Green Blue Gradient – Contemporary Iridescent Abstract Painting
This work features a shift in hues from gold to green, then to deep blue, in a gentle but contrasting transition. Worked with a knife, the material creates irregular reliefs that catch the light and reveal iridescent reflections in motion.
Here, green lies at the crossroads of plant and mineral, between golden light and aquatic depth. The final, almost nocturnal blue anchors the composition and creates a balance between freshness, stability and density.
This painting evokes an abstract landscape - between moss, stone and water - without ever depicting it. It exudes a soothing, natural energy, ideal for a calm, uncluttered interior or one inspired by the elements.
